Guys I need your help in removing the stock HSF from my 8500 graphics card. I have a crystal orb sitting in front of me. How do I remove the orignal HSF from the GPU without damaging the processor. Put it in a zip lock bag and seal it and put in the freezer for about 20min than pull off.The cold makes the glue brital and it can be pulled off

Or you can try to soften the glue up with heat. Either by looping a vid benchmark for about half an hour then attempt to remove it as soon as you shut down, or use a hairdryer on it.

Using eyeglass flathead screwdriver to slowly pry around the base of the heatsink will get it off very easily, this is how I got the heatsink off my Radeon 7500 to put on the Crystal Orb.

It is the easiest method, personally I would skip on the freezer method.

Just do not put the flathead srewdriver to far under the side of the heatsink. Anything else that is roughly the same size and made of plastic wil work fine as long as it can fit along the edge of the heatsink and slowly pry upwards going around the entire heasink 2 to 3 times. It took me not even 5 minutes and it was very easy.
